Abstract
We have carried out magnetic and Mössbauer studies of amorphous Fe80âxTmxB20 alloys (0 â¤Â x â¤Â 16). With an increasing Tm content, both the Curie temperature TC and the magnetic moment of Fe atom μFe decrease. We have extracted the value of exchange constant A from TC and that of the local magnetic anisotropy constant KL from the coercivity. Mössbauer studies were performed in a transmission geometry and also using the conversion electron spectroscopy. Both Mössbauer spectrometry techniques show that the average hyperfine field decreases linearly with the addition of rare-earth.
